The Art of Negotiation and Settlement
A skilled legal strategist recognizes the potential for settlement and negotiation long before the courtroom. They analyze the strengths and weaknesses of their case, and those of the opposing party, to determine the most favorable outcome. This often involves detailed financial analysis, assessing potential risks, and evaluating the emotional and reputational implications of a trial.
- Early intervention: Identifying opportunities for settlement can save time and resources.
- Negotiation expertise: Mastering the art of negotiation is fundamental to achieving favorable settlements.
- Risk assessment: Evaluating the risks associated with a trial is crucial in determining the best course of action.

Intellectual Property Disputes
In intellectual property cases, a strategist might use a combination of legal precedents and market analysis to demonstrate the value of the intellectual property in question. This can involve expert testimony from industry leaders and detailed financial projections.
Contract Disputes
In contract disputes, a strategist might identify ambiguities in the contract or demonstrate how the other party breached the agreement. This could involve expert legal analysis and evidence of damages incurred as a result of the breach.
